The AJP connector in Apache Tomcat 5.5.15 uses an incorrect length for chunks, which can cause a buffer over-read in the ajp_process_callback in mod_jk, which allows remote attackers to read portions of sensitive memory.

This issue can let a remote attacker read unintended memory from systems using the Apache Tomcat 5.5.15 AJP connector with mod_jk handling. That memory could contain sensitive data. The provided sources do not include a CVSS score, confirmed active exploitation, or complete affected-version guidance. Likely limited to legacy Apache Tomcat 5.5.15 environments using the AJP connector with mod_jk. Internet exposure depends on whether AJP-facing infrastructure is reachable by untrusted networks. The source bundle does not identify affected CPEs or a full product matrix. Treat this as a legacy exposure review item, not an emergency based on current evidence. If Tomcat 5.5.15 with AJP and mod_jk exists in production, prioritize verification and vendor-guided remediation because the impact is potential sensitive memory disclosure.
